Output 7d725503fa856017a493dab9a4ac4a164d94dd6f22d5f094a1e917dcf4947fbe:0

value
28488320
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91fe4dfb868dd92db7d7a74a656d84b1fbfec427 OP_EQUAL
address
3EzxYkgHUkWE6mfWPPkj3GfP693Qds9xw3
transaction
7d725503fa856017a493dab9a4ac4a164d94dd6f22d5f094a1e917dcf4947fbe
confirmations
54534
spent
true